    South Dakota gets a QB commit from Illinois,
    Hayden Ekern - 6’ 1” 194 - Chicago (St Rita)
    At one time was a commit to Montana State, but MSU chose not to stay with the offer after a coaching staff change. Had been on the Fighting Hawks’ radar also......

    Jacks grabbed a PWO athlete from South Dakota. Joey Slama. Same high school as Jackrabbit legend Josh Ranek.

    They also got a verbal from a DE from Florida. Zac Wilson, 6'4, 225. He held offers from FAMU, Bethune Cookman, and Dartmouth. He's the 4th DE the Jacks have signed for this class (3 scholly, 1 PWO).
